Expidition Roof Rack - Removal

Hi,

Is it straight forward to remove the Expidition Roof Rack?

The reason I'm asking is that I'm considering getting a new D3 (in 2 1/2 weeks) or a D4 (in 2 1/2 months) and will want to retain having a Roof Rack.

Its been a while but yes the hardest bit is lifting it off but one person each side and walk backwards ie not over the bonnet

Hi buddy Thumbs Up Yep the hardest bit is the lifting.

I suspect if you have not taken your rack off since you got it, your nuts might be seized, so maybe an investment in a suitable drill and screw extractor for the front fixings might be a good idea.
